  • Cordless Drill/Driver:

A cordless drill/driver is arguably the most versatile power tool for engineers. From drilling holes to driving screws, this tool offers unparalleled convenience and flexibility. Look for models with variable speed settings, ergonomic design, and high torque capabilities for handling a variety of materials and applications. Whether you're assembling structures, installing fixtures, or fabricating prototypes, a reliable cordless drill/driver will be your go-to companion.

  • Angle Grinder:

When it comes to shaping, grinding, and cutting metal, there's no substitute for an angle grinder. With its rotating abrasive disc, this power tool excels at tasks such as smoothing welds, removing rust, and shaping metal components with precision. Opt for a model with adjustable guard positions, auxiliary handles, and powerful motors to tackle demanding engineering projects with ease. From fabricating custom parts to refurbishing machinery, an angle grinder is an indispensable tool for engineers working with metal.

  • Rotary Hammer:

For heavy-duty drilling tasks, especially in concrete and masonry, a rotary hammer is a must-have power tool. Unlike standard drills, rotary hammers combine rotation with a pounding action, making them incredibly effective for drilling into tough materials. Whether you're anchoring structural elements, installing utilities, or excavating for soil sampling, a rotary hammer will deliver the power and performance needed to get the job done efficiently. Look for features such as multiple operating modes, anti-vibration technology, and compatibility with various drill bits for maximum versatility.

  • Circular Saw:

  • When precision cutting is essential, a circular saw is the tool of choice for engineers. Whether you're working with wood, plastic, or composite materials, this power tool offers unmatched accuracy and efficiency. Look for models with adjustable cutting depths, bevel capacities, and ergonomic handles for optimal control and versatility. From building prototypes to constructing frameworks, a high-quality circular saw will enable engineers to achieve clean, straight cuts with ease.

    • Jigsaw:

    The jigsaw is a versatile addition to any engineer's toolkit. With its reciprocating blade, a jigsaw is perfect for cutting curves, straight lines, and intricate shapes in various materials such as wood, metal, and plastic. Look for models with variable speed controls, orbital action settings, and tool-free blade changing mechanisms for enhanced versatility and ease of use. Whether you're crafting prototypes, fabricating components, or performing intricate modifications, a jigsaw offers precision and flexibility unmatched by other power tools.
